The Manchester derby is always a fascinating game. A battle that was once in complete control of the Red Devils has flipped in recent years – with the rise of the Citizens, from foreign ownership to the arrival of Pep Guardiola – and in recent years has become a game where the team in azure is with its hand on the top, usually. Tomorrow (Wednesday), the teams will meet in the League Cup semi-finals.

Pep Guardiola will miss Ederson, Gabriel Jesus, Kyle Walker, Eric Garcia and Fran Torres in the derby, who were also absent 1-3 at Chelsea due to the Corona virus. Phil Foden, Riyad Mahraz, Con Aguero and Kevin de Bruyne are expected to open in the Spaniard’s 11.

“We don’t have a lot of players for the derby,” he said Guardiola“Playing one or two games in this squad is fine, but over time we will not be able to use only 14 or 15 players. It will be more difficult.”

“Aguero is still not 100% qualified, but we have to adapt to the situation. We have no other alternative. The important thing is that the players who are sick in Corona are recovering. The rest have to be careful because there are risks.”

On the negotiations with de Bruyne over the contract extension, Pep said: “I’m pretty sure he will stay, I’m not worried. He knows how much we value him as a footballer and as a person and how important he is to the club. There are negotiations and the process must be respected. ”

And what about United? Last season the Red Devils lost in the quarterfinals, 1: 2 to Bristol City, and the coach Ola-Gunnar Solskjaer Expressed hope that this time the script will be different: “It will be a very big step to get our hands on the title. We have developed a lot in the last year. It is not only a matter of winning the semi-finals, but also our ability and confidence, so no excuses.”

“Playing football to win titles, to lift the trophy, even though when you win, you already think about the next one. But it gives hunger to win the most. The staff is focused, willing to give it their all and well prepared for the game.” The Reds will hope to bring the ability from the league to the cup after achieving three wins in the last four games.

Manchester United will arrive without Edinson Cavani, who despite being one of the players’ union in Uruguay, is still serving a suspension, and the Norwegian said: “We are disappointed he will not be in the game. It’s a very good situation to be in. “

Also, Manchester United are expected to come up with a strong squad that will include Anthony Martial, Marcus Rashford, Bruno Fernandez and Paul Pogba.
